Exports will see turnaround in last quarter: Anand Sharma

Source: NewKerala
New Delhi : India | about 1 month ago  
Views: 1
In the final quarter of this fiscal, we will see positive growth," Sharma told reporters at the annual Economic Editors' Conference here. "We will be able to achieve the target of doubling India's exports of goods and services by 2014 and also doubling our share in global exports by 2020," he added.
